How Do I Pick?

What colour? Patterns or solids? Dark or light? If you are not sure where to start, consider the colors that you already have in your room. Lighter colours easily complement darker colours by with a stunning contrast. Using similar, lighter colours to your background such as white create a sense of openness, spaciousness and freedom. The most important thing to remember is it’s your room, as long as you are happy with it nothing else matters!

Will it go with the accent pillows I already have? Accent pillows are lovely touches that you can add to a room in different spots or on various types of furniture. If the pillows won’t match your new sofa, it can be fun to freshen up the room with new ones.

What type of style do I prefer? If you are unsure about the kind of style of furniture that will work for you, think about your home style and personality and how you want to present your home to guests. You may prefer old traditional styles with wood, print or mosaic patterned fabrics or a modern look with metals and solid colors.

Choose the right upholstery. Cotton and twill oversized accent chairs can hold up to heavy use and have a pleasant texture to ensure comfort. For chairs that will be used less frequently, consider a luxurious fabric like velvet, linen, or chenille. Genuine leather and faux leather also have a sumptuous feel but are very simple to clean. Polyester and polyester-blends will remain vivid in areas that are exposed to intense sunlight.

Consider frame construction. For furniture that can hold up to years of daily use, focus on pieces that feature kiln-dried hardwood frames. Ones with reinforced corner blocked joints or screwed, glued, or doweled joints will be the absolute sturdiest. Plywood and particleboard frames are a more economical choice.

Compare support, hand-tied seats are comfortable and responsive, while seats with sinuous springs are slightly softer. Webbing suspension keeps the cost of seats low and gives chairs less support.

Final consideration is filling. If softness and plushness are your top priority, look for chairs that are filled with down or feathers. High-density foam filing is commonly used in accent chairs due to its durability and comfortable support. Prefer chairs with a smoother look? Options with wool or cotton batting will suit your tastes.
